How Much Do Sociology Graduates from University of Maryland-College Park Make?

$53,258 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Sociology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

Sociology students who finish a bachelor’s at University of Maryland-College Park earn a median of $53,258 a year. This is lower than $78,942, the median for all majors at University of Maryland-College Park.

How Much Student Debt Do Sociology Graduates from University of Maryland-College Park Have?

$20,460 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Sociology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

While getting their bachelor’s degree at University of Maryland-College Park, sociology graduates take on a median debt of $20,460 in student loans. This is below $20,836, the typical median for all majors at University of Maryland-College Park.

University of Maryland-College Park Sociology Bachelor’s Program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 33% of sociology bachelor’s degrees went to men and 67% went to women.

University of Maryland-College Park gender breakdown of Sociology Bachelor's degree grads

The largest share of sociology bachelor’s degree graduates at University of Maryland-College Park are White. Roughly 32%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of Maryland-College Park with a bachelor’s in sociology.

Ethnic diversity of Sociology majors at University of Maryland-College Park
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 11
Black or African American 28
Hispanic or Latino 12
White 31
Non-Resident Aliens 4
Other Races 12
